The concept of a rural Texas Sheriff being the High Sheriff of his county survived into the 1950's. The High Sheriff was the master of the county courthouse, feudal lord of the county territory, and keeper of the bloodhounds. His patrol car might appear on any road at any time. The author interviewed 20 sheriffs and included 11 of their best stories in this book. No previous owner marks. Text and photos clean and bright. Spine very slightly tilted.
